Sink Overflow Water Removal vs. DIY: When to Call a Professional
| Situation | DIY? | Call a Pro? | Why |
|---|---|---|---|
| Small water spill with minimal damage | Yes | No | You can clean up the mess yourself with a wet vacuum and some towels. |
| Large water spill with significant damage | No | Yes | You’ll need specialized equipment and expertise to extract water and dry out your property. |
| Visible signs of mold or mildew growth | No | Yes | This is a serious health risk that needs prompt attention from a professional. |
| Structural damage to your property | No | Yes | This can be a costly repair if left unchecked, so it’s best to call a professional. |
| Unknown source of the overflow | No | Yes | You’ll need expert help to identify and fix the root cause of the problem. |

Sink Overflow Water Removal Cost in Escatawpa, MS
The cost of sink overflow water removal can vary depending on the severity of the damage and the size of the affected area. On average, homeowners can expect to pay between $500 and $2,500 for a comprehensive service. But, prices can range from as low as $100 for a small water spill to as high as $10,000 or more for a major flood. The cost will depend on a variety of factors including the size of the affected area, the type of materials damaged, and the level of restoration required.
| Service | Typical Price Range | What Affects Cost |
|---|---|---|
| Initial Assessment and Inspection | $100 – $500 | The size of the affected area and the level of damage. |
| Water Extraction and Drying | $500 – $2,000 | The size of the affected area and the type of materials damaged. |
| Structural Drying and Repair | $1,000 – $5,000 | The extent of the structural damage and the type of materials required for repair. |
| Mold Remediation and Prevention | $500 – $2,000 | The size of the affected area and the level of mold growth. |
| Final Inspection and Cleaning | $100 – $500 | The size of the affected area and the level of cleaning required. |

Common Questions About Sink Overflow Water Removal
What causes sink overflows?
Sink overflows can be caused by a variety of factors, including clogged pipes, corroded pipes, and excessive water pressure. It’s essential to identify the root cause of the problem to prevent further damage and costly repairs.
How long does sink overflow water removal take?
The length of time it takes to remove water from a sink overflow depends on the severity of the damage and the size of the affected area. On average, it can take anywhere from a few hours to several days to complete the service.
Is sink overflow water removal covered by insurance?
It depends on your insurance policy and the circumstances surrounding the sink overflow. It’s essential to check with your insurance provider to find out what is covered and what is not.
